Roasted Asparagus & Balsamic Brown Butter with Pasta 
This was one of the first recipes I ever pinned to my Pinterest board, and one I actually moved to my "Pinned & Made" folder early on (don't even get me started on the ratio of pinned to madeJ) hahahahhahaa)  The recipe sounds SUPER FANCY, but is actually sooooooooooooo easy!  

First up is the roasted asparagus (at 350 for 30 minutes)...

Then I boiled some pasta, and while I had it draining in the sink, I added the 1/2 cup of balsamic RIGHT to the spaghetti pot in an effort to do ONE LESS DISH with tonight's dinner!  hahahahahhaa... 

After you let the balsamic boil down for about 5 minutes, you add in a 1/2 teaspoon of brown sugar and a few tablespoons of butter and allow that to melt all together... 

Once the butter is melted, toss in the pasta, asparagus & 1/3 cup of grated cheese and MIX, MIX, MIX! 

How easy is THAT???  And I'm tellin ya, the balsamic/butter sauce is NOT to be believed!!!  Boiling the balsamic (and the help of the pinch of brown sugar) sweetens it up, while the butter makes it lovely & luscious.  And we swapped penne for angel hair in the recipe, so you occasionally get a nice twirl of roasted asparagus mixed in.  DELISH!
